    you do not give too much details. But for burning a dvd with Movie Edit Pro, I think one thing must be figured out. The one you are specifically interested in is the "Disc images:" path.  This is the folder where MEP creates the actual DVD disc images during encoding.  It then burns those images to your DVD.
    As an extra note, MEP never automatically deletes these images, which means they will eventually fill up your HDD.  Believe me, I learned this the hard way.  After I'm sure my DVD plays correctly, I always go back and delete those files.Hopefully, this solves your problem.
